Full coverage car insurance typically consists of three crucial components: liability coverage, collision coverage, and comprehensive coverage. Liability coverage pays for damages and injuries you cause to other people in an accident. This is especially important in rural areas where road conditions can be unpredictable, and wildlife encounters are a common risk. Collision coverage helps cover the cost of repairs to your vehicle if involved in an accident, regardless of fault. Lastly, comprehensive coverage offers protection against non-collision events such as theft, vandalism, or natural disasters—factors that can be more prevalent in sparsely populated areas.

It’s important for Colorado's rural drivers to be aware of how local weather conditions can affect their insurance needs. The state is renowned for its sudden storms, icy roads, and heavy snowfall during winter months. Having comprehensive coverage can aid in dealing with damages that may arise from inclement weather. Furthermore, drivers should consider wildlife collision coverage due to the high likelihood of deer and other animals on rural roadways.

Another factor influencing full coverage car insurance rates in rural Colorado is the issue of theft. Some remote areas may experience higher rates of vehicle theft, making comprehensive coverage essential. It’s advisable for drivers to assess their surroundings and choose a policy that adequately addresses the risks prevalent in their particular location.

When selecting full coverage car insurance, rural drivers should also take advantage of discounts. Many insurers offer savings for bundling home and auto policies, having a good driving record, or even completing a defensive driving course. Shopping around and comparing quotes from various providers can significantly lower premiums while ensuring adequate coverage levels.
